技术文摘
Hibernate dbcp连接池使用方法概述
Hibernate dbcp连接池使用方法概述
在现代的Java应用程序开发中,数据库连接的管理是一个至关重要的环节。Hibernate作为一款优秀的对象关系映射框架,结合dbcp连接池能够高效地管理数据库连接,提升应用程序的性能和稳定性。本文将对Hibernate dbcp连接池的使用方法进行概述。
要使用Hibernate dbcp连接池,需要在项目中添加相应的依赖。通常,需要引入Hibernate核心库以及dbcp连接池相关的库。确保这些依赖正确添加到项目的构建文件中,例如Maven或Gradle的配置文件。
接下来,配置Hibernate的配置文件。在配置文件中,需要指定数据库连接的相关信息,如数据库驱动、连接URL、用户名和密码等。还需要配置dbcp连接池的相关参数,例如最大连接数、最小空闲连接数、连接超时时间等。这些参数的合理配置对于连接池的性能和资源管理至关重要。
在配置好相关参数后,就可以在代码中使用Hibernate dbcp连接池了。通过Hibernate的SessionFactory来获取数据库连接。SessionFactory是Hibernate的核心接口之一,它负责创建和管理Session对象,而Session对象则用于与数据库进行交互。
在获取Session对象时,Hibernate会从dbcp连接池中获取一个可用的数据库连接。当使用完Session对象后,需要及时关闭它,以便将连接归还给连接池。这样,连接池可以有效地管理和复用数据库连接,避免频繁地创建和销毁连接,从而提高应用程序的性能。
还需要注意连接池的监控和管理。可以通过一些工具和方法来监控连接池的状态,如连接数、空闲连接数、等待连接的线程数等。及时发现和解决连接池中的问题,确保应用程序的稳定运行。
Hibernate dbcp连接池的使用可以大大提高Java应用程序与数据库交互的效率和性能。通过正确的配置和合理的使用,能够有效地管理数据库连接资源,为应用程序的稳定运行提供保障。
- Win7 磁盘工具的快速打开方法
- Win7 更新出现错误代码 8007000E 如何解决
- Win7 系统开机跳过硬盘自检的设置方法
- 解决 Windows7 系统固态硬盘卡顿假死的方法
- Win7 系统重装后耳机无声的解决办法
- Win7 中 CAXA 电子图版频繁崩溃停止工作的解决办法
- Windows7 文件搜索自动中断的解决办法
- Win7 旗舰版连接打印机出现 0x00000002 错误的解决办法
- Win7 系统怎样查找大文件
- Win7 系统中 hiberfil.sys 文件能否删除及该文件介绍
- Win7 64 位旗舰版运行 regsvr32.exe 注册 32 位 dll 版本不兼容的解决之道
- Win7 系统注册表编辑器无法使用的解决之策
- Win7 不重装电脑恢复出厂设置的方法
- Win7 不依赖第三方软件的定时关机设置方法
- Win7 旗舰版找不到移动硬盘的解决办法 无法识别移动硬盘应对策略